LOUISVILLE, Ky. - April 30, 2018 // GLOBE NEWSWIRE // - Texas Roadhouse, Inc. (Nasdaq:TXRH), today announced financial results for the 13 week period ended March 27, 2018.
View Original for Full Data Table
Kent Taylor, Chief Executive Officer of Texas Roadhouse, Inc., commented, "We are pleased to report another solid quarter highlighted by double-digit revenue growth and comparable restaurant sales growth of 4.9%. This sales growth was largely driven by traffic gains which have continued into the second quarter. While restaurant margins remain challenged by ongoing labor inflation, our operators have remained focused on providing our guests with a legendary experience. On the development front, our new restaurant pipeline is in good shape with 11 company restaurants and two international franchise restaurants, including our first in Mexico, open so far this year."
Comparable restaurant sales at company restaurants for the first four weeks of our second quarter of fiscal 2018 increased approximately 8.5% compared to the prior year period.

Non-GAAP Measures
We prepare our consolidated financial statements in accordance with U.S. generally accepted accounting principles (“GAAP”). Within our press release, we make reference to restaurant margin (in dollars and as a percentage of sales). Restaurant margin represents restaurant and other sales less restaurant-level operating costs, including cost of sales, labor, rent and other operating costs. Restaurant margin should not be considered in isolation, or as an alternative, to income from operations. This non-GAAP measure is not indicative of overall company performance and profitability in that this measure does not accrue directly to the benefit of shareholders due to the nature of the costs excluded. Restaurant margin is widely regarded as a useful metric by which to evaluate restaurant-level operating efficiency and performance. In calculating restaurant margin, we exclude certain non-restaurant-level costs that support operations, including pre-opening and general and administrative expenses, but do not have a direct impact on restaurant-level operational efficiency and performance. We also exclude depreciation and amortization expense, substantially all of which relates to restaurant-level assets, as it represents a non-cash charge for the investment in our restaurants. We also exclude impairment and closure expense as we believe this provides a clearer perspective of ongoing operating performance and a more useful comparison to prior period results. Restaurant margin as presented may not be comparable to other similarly titled measures of other companies in our industry. A reconciliation of income from operations to restaurant margin is included in the accompanying financial tables.

Texas Roadhouse is a casual dining concept that first opened in 1993 and today has grown to over 560 restaurants system-wide in 49 states and eight foreign countries. For more information, please visit the Company’s Web site at www.texasroadhouse.com.
